Product description
- Budget product for sports vehicles
- Reduced rolling noise
- Suitable for use on rough roads
In the winter range of products, the Snowace2 Hp Aw09 from the Aeolus manufacturer can be found. Built for the road and the expressway, it is ideal with sports vehicles.
Versions offering the OWR (One Way Rotation) label on the sidewall are built with one rolling direction. Finally, the product is available with the "3PMSF" and "M+S" markings on its sidewall, which means this tyre will accompany you when driving on very bare paths but also on snowy roads.
Its key point is limited noise levels in the passenger compartment.
What is the rezulteo score?
The rezulteo score is calculated considering three performance categories: economy, comfort and safety. When it comes to winter tyres, the performance criteria snow and ice are added. By weighting different basic performance criteria an overall score is determined. This weighting is calculated based on the tyre size category: economic, high performance or sports.
